Dear Parents and Guardians

This Sunday, we honour the inspiring role men play in their children’s lives. Unsurprisingly, children are constantly observing the significant men in their lives and learn lifelong strategies to help navigate this wonderful life with which we’ve been gifted. Life can be ‘rocky’ at times and our children are looking to us to see how we cope and manage everyday situations. As men, we should never underestimate the import role we play in our children’s lives. For fathers who cannot always be physically present to their children, be comforted in the belief that your children will continue to need your positive influence in the long term. As men, we need to look after our mental health and physical wellbeing in order to be active and present as older fathers and grandfathers in the future. I truly hope Sunday is an enjoyable time where our fathers are spoilt and made to feel special! Happy Fathers’ Day men!

Virtue The virtue of the week is prayerfulness. Prayerfulness can be practised in many ways.

Prayer is talking to God in silence or out loud. Prayerfulness is living in a way which shows that you are in the presence of God. It is listening and receiving God’s guidance. We are practising prayerfulness, when we: Take time every day to pray and reflect Talk to God as we would to a really good friend Share our thoughts, hopes, needs and fears in

prayer Trust, listen and watch for God’s answer Take action with trust and Have an attitude of gratitude Father’s Day

BOOK WEEK 2017 4 – 8 September Escape to Everywhere

Book Week this year will be celebrated from Monday 4 to Friday 8 September. The theme this year is Escape to Everywhere highlighting that through books one can escape to anywhere that the author’s and reader’s minds can imagine. Some of the highlights of the week will be the Book Character Parade on Wednesday morning from 8:35am where students can dress as any book character they like. The Author and Illustrator talks on Tuesday and Thursday will be entertaining and informative. For the younger students, the Super Duper shows on Monday are sure to be great favourites. The Book Week Art Activities will be centred around the shortlisted Children’s Book Council of Australia books and Zart Art book. The Book Warehouse Book Fair will provide the opportunity for students to purchase reasonably priced books. The Book Fair will be open for purchases on Monday 4, Tuesday 5, Thursday 7 and Friday 8 September from 8:00am-8:35am and from 3:00pm-3:30pm. Children will also be able to purchase books throughout Book Week during their normal Library times. Books will be on display the week before Book Week (i.e. 28 August to 1 September) to allow students to see what is available and establish their wish lists. Parents are requested to send money in an envelope clearly marked with the student’s name and requested book title. Preps may need guidance as to what is a suitable book for their reading level.
